
设计模式笔记
文章平均质量分 96
学习设计模式的一些笔记,不断整理改进。
参考视频:尚硅谷Java设计模式
doordiey
这个作者很懒,什么都没留下…
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
设计模式之七大设计原则
设计模式 目的:为了让程序有更好的代码的重用性(相同功能代码不用多次编写)、可读性(编程的规范性)、可扩展性(增加新的功能时,非常的方便)、可靠性(当增加新功能后,对原有功能没有影响)、使程序呈现高内聚,低耦合。 单一职责原则 基本介绍 对类来说,即一个类只负责一项指责x 应用实例 交通工具运行方式举例 方式1中run 方法,违法了单一职责原则,解决该办法,根据不同的方式,拆分不同的类出来。 方式2中遵守了单一职责原则,但改动很大,将类分解了,修改过多。 方式3中没有对类进行大改动,只是增加方法原创 2021-07-16 09:24:14 · 254 阅读 · 2 评论 -
设计模式之单例模式介绍及实现
单例模式 简单介绍 采取一定的方法保证在整个软件系统中,对某个类只能存在一个对象实例,并且该类只提供一个取得其对象实例的方法(静态方法) 单例模式的不同写法 饿汉式(静态常量) 应用实例 构造器私有化(防止 new) 类的内部创建对象 向外暴露一个静态的公共方法 代码实现 代码 package singleton; /** * @Author: doordiey * @Date: Created in 10:40 2020/8/20 */ public class Singletontest原创 2020-10-18 16:00:53 · 181 阅读 · 0 评论